Auxiliary socket (AUX)
Auxiliary JACK socket
Do not connect a device to the USB port and to the auxiliary
Jack socket at the same time.
The auxiliary Jack socket permits the connection of a portable
non-mass storage device or an Apple
® player if not recognised
by the USB port.
Connect the portable device to the auxiliary Jack socket using
a suitable cable (not supplied).
Press the SOURCE
or SRC
button
several times in succession and select
" AUX
".
First adjust the volume on your portable device.
Then adjust the volume of the audio
system.
The display and management of controls is on the
portable device.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
QUESTION
ANSWER
SOLUTION
The message "USB
peripheral error"
or "Peripheral not
recognised" is displayed
in the screen. The USB memory stick is not recognised.
The memory stick may be corrupt. Reformat the memory stick (FAT 32).
A telephone connects
automatically,
disconnecting another
telephone. Automatic connection overrides manual connection. Modify the telephone settings to remove automatic
connection.
The Apple
®
player is
not recognised when
connecting to the USB
port. The Apple ®
player is of a generation that is not compatible with the USB. Connect the Apple ®
player to the AUX Jack socket
using a suitable cable (not supplied).
When I connect my
Apple
® player or my
BlackBerry ® to the
USB port, I have alert
messages on the current
consumption by the USB
port. When charging, the current consumption of these smartphones is greater
than the rating of the USB port, which is 500 mA.
The hard disk or device
is not recognised when
connecting to the USB
port. Some hard disks and devices need a power supply greater than is
provided by the audio system. Connect the device to the 230 V socket, the 12 V
socket or an external power supply.
Caution
: ensure that the device does not transmit
a voltage greater than 5 V (risk of destruction of
the system).
